Polio Toolkit

"...evidence-driven communication strategies to help vaccinate every child."
The Polio Toolkit, a web-based repository of social and behaviour change (SBC) resources, is designed to improve sharing of information, SBC guidance, and learnings between the Global Polio Eradication Initiative (GPEI), local partners, organisations, and frontline workers working to eradicate polio worldwide. The Polio Toolkit was launched in August 2022 by the United Nations Children's Fund (UNICEF), which manages the site as one of the GPEI partners.
To facilitate identification of resources in the Polio Toolkit library, the site offers a search function, in English and French, and various filtering tools. It also provides learning opportunities, including access to: courses in UNICEF's free Agora portal; the 4-part Polio Communication Global Guide; a set of tools and resources for collecting and using social data; UNICEF's framework approach to misinformation management; techniques and strategies developed by the UNICEF/Public Good Projects Digital Community Engagement Unit, and more. The Polio Toolkit features communication guidance for the introduction of novel oral polio vaccine (nOPV2), the newest tool in the battle against polio outbreaks.
